What Is TIA Coin and Why Does Celestia Matter?

Celestia went live in late 2023 with a bold pitch: separate consensus from execution and let anyone roll up their own blockchain without bootstrapping an entire validator set. TIA is the lifeblood of that system — used for staking, paying gas, and securing the network through proof-of-stake. In short, if Celestia is the highway, TIA is the fuel.

Unlike traditional Layer-1 chains that handle every job from transaction ordering to smart-contract execution, Celestia focuses narrowly on one critical thing: making sure transaction data is available and verifiable. This "data availability" layer acts like a shared hard drive for rollups, drastically reducing the cost and complexity of launching a new chain.

That focus earned Celestia the unofficial title of the first true modular blockchain, and TIA has ridden that narrative hard since day one. How TIA Powers the Modular Stack

TIA isn't just a governance token — it's functional in three core ways that tie its value directly to network activity:

  • Gas fees: Users pay TIA to publish data blobs to Celestia. Every byte of rollup data needs TIA behind it.
  • Staking: Validators and delegators lock TIA to secure the network and earn staking rewards, slashing any malicious actors along the way.
  • Governance: TIA holders vote on upgrades, parameter changes, and treasury allocations — giving the token real say in Celestia's direction.

Under the hood, Celestia uses a novel sampling technique called data availability sampling (DAS). Light nodes check small random chunks of block data, making it possible to verify huge blocks without downloading them in full. The result: high throughput without sacrificing decentralization — a trade-off that monolithic chains have struggled with for years.

Rollups and the TIA Fee Model

Every rollup that publishes data through Celestia pays for blobspace in TIA. As more rollups — from Ethereum L2s to purpose-built appchains — plug into Celestia for cheap data availability, demand for TIA should rise organically. It's a fee-driven value-accrual model similar in spirit to how ETH captures value from L2 activity, but applied specifically to the data layer rather than execution.

For developers, this means launching a chain no longer requires securing a multi-million-dollar validator set. For TIA holders, it means the token's long-term thesis is tied to a real economic loop: more rollups → more blob demand → more TIA burned or locked.

TIA Tokenomics at a Glance

TIA launched with a fixed total supply of 1 billion tokens and an inflation schedule designed to taper over time. Key facts every holder should know:

  • Initial circulating supply at launch was roughly 7% of the total, with the rest vesting over several years.
  • Annual inflation starts at around 8% and decreases by roughly 10% each year until a hard floor of 1.5%.
  • Unlocks for early investors, team members, and ecosystem funds are spread over multiple years, creating periodic overhangs on price.
  • Staking yield has fluctuated with network participation, generally hovering in the double-digit percentage range in the early months after launch.

That staking yield is a major pull for yield-seeking crypto natives, though it's worth remembering that high nominal yields on inflationary tokens require real-rate analysis. The headline APR might look juicy, but inflation eats into it.

Risks, Competition, and the Road Ahead

No token is without risk, and TIA is no exception. The biggest headwinds investors should track include:

  • Competition from EigenDA and Avail, which are also building data-availability layers — including EigenDA's tight integration with Ethereum restaking via EigenLayer.
  • Unlock-driven sell pressure, especially during the first two years when a significant portion of the supply becomes liquid and early backers can take profits.
  • Adoption uncertainty, since TIA's value ultimately depends on rollups choosing Celestia over alternatives — and many builders hedge across multiple DA layers.

On the upside, Celestia's narrative remains strong. The project has secured partnerships with major rollup frameworks and raised significant venture funding before launch. If modular blockchains become the default architecture for Web3 — as many VCs and core developers believe — TIA could end up sitting on top of a multi-billion-dollar fee economy.
